Career background and major roles
Hargitay began acting in the early 1990s, appearing in smaller television shows and films before landing a breakthrough role in 1999. That role on a popular NBC series established her as a leading performer and set the stage for future opportunities.
Over time, her responsibilities on set expanded beyond acting into consulting and producing. This shift allowed her to influence storylines and contribute to workplace culture, increasing her value to the production and her earning potential.
